I think we're > > > mostly there with prep, but needs to pondering of corner cases. > > I wonder - should this code consistently use __acquire() etc so we could > > get a little static analysis help for the locking? > > > > I have not played with this for several years and I do not know the > > maturity of this today. > > Ime these sparse annotations are pretty useless because too inflexible. I > tend to use runtime locking checks based on lockdep. Those are more > accurate, and work even when the place the lock is taken is very far away > from where you're checking, without having to annoate all functions in > between. We need that for something like console_lock which is a very big > lock. Only downside is that only paths you hit at runtime are checked. > > > > - move fbcon.c from using indices for tracking fb_info (and accessing > > > registered_fbs without proper locking all the time) to real fb_info > > > pointers with the right amount of refcounting.
